Living in Harshaw Lake Park means enduring the relentless summer heat and sudden, fierce thunderstorms that roll in from the bay. These environmental factors can take a substantial toll on your home’s roof. Homeowners often notice warning signs that indicate their roofing system might be compromised and in urgent need of attention.

  • Uneven shingles or cracking: Constant exposure to intense sunlight and heavy rains can cause shingles to warp, crack, or peel, creating pathways for water infiltration.
  • Excessive heat buildup: Traditional roofing materials may not effectively reduce the mounting heat on your roof, leading to increased indoor temperatures and energy bills.
  • Storm damage evidence: After sudden storms, missing granules or minor leaks might seem trivial but can escalate into significant structural problems if ignored.
  • Energy inefficiency: Older roofs lacking solar integration or reflective materials allow more heat absorption, putting pressure on your cooling systems.

Ignoring these symptoms risks water damage, mold, diminished property value, and soaring energy costs. Timely attention is vital to ensure your home’s longevity and comfort.

Why Choose Roofing From Classic Roofing & Construction?

As you compare roofers for your next home improvement project in St. Petersburg, Tampa or Clearwater, consider:

  • How long the roofing company has been in business and if they are locally owned.
  • The quality of the roofing materials they use and if those materials are backed with a long warranty.
  • If the work is done by subcontractors or certified, professional installers.
  • The financing options and conditions the company offers.
  • What online reviews say about the company’s work.
